For printing large letters, choosing the right paper is key to achieving clean, crisp results. Opt for heavyweight paper that offers a smooth surface to ensure the ink doesn’t bleed. A good choice is 80-100 lb card stock, which provides sturdiness while maintaining print quality.
Glossy vs. Matte
If you want your letters to stand out with vibrant colors, go for a glossy finish. It enhances color depth and provides a shiny, polished look. Matte paper, on the other hand, is ideal for a more subdued, professional appearance without the glare, making it a great option for signage or instructional materials.
Recycled Paper
If sustainability is a priority, consider recycled paper options. These papers are available in various weights and finishes, offering a durable, eco-friendly alternative. While the texture may differ slightly from traditional options, recycled papers still produce clear prints when used with the right printer settings.
Large letters serve as a fantastic tool for children’s educational activities. Use these templates to help kids practice writing, improve letter recognition, and enhance motor skills. Whether for home, school, or creative play, large letters are an excellent resource for engaging young learners.
Letter Tracing
Encourage children to trace large letters with their fingers or a pencil. This simple activity builds fine motor skills while reinforcing letter shapes. You can provide a variety of materials, such as colored markers or stickers, to make the activity more fun and engaging.
Matching Games
Print multiple copies of large letters and use them for matching games. For example, write the uppercase letter on one card and the corresponding lowercase letter on another. Children can match them while improving their understanding of letter pairs and alphabet sequencing.
- Use different colored paper for variety.
- Incorporate pictures of objects that start with the same letter.
- Challenge kids to find objects around the house that match each letter.
By incorporating large letter templates into daily activities, children can develop early literacy skills in a hands-on and enjoyable way.
Choose from a variety of font styles to personalize your alphabet templates. Bold, cursive, or modern fonts can suit any project, from classroom materials to home decor. Select a font that aligns with the tone of your activity, whether it’s playful, formal, or artistic.
Popular Printable Font Styles
Consider these popular font styles when selecting printable templates:
- Sans-serif: Clean and simple, ideal for easy reading.
- Serif: Traditional and classic, perfect for formal uses.
- Cursive: Elegant and fluid, great for invitations or creative projects.
- Block Letters: Bold and impactful, suitable for kids’ activities or posters.
Font Size and Customization Tips
Adjust the font size to fit your project needs. Larger letters are better for big posters or wall art, while smaller ones work well for worksheets or educational materials. Many font generators allow you to tweak spacing, style, and even add decorative elements to your templates.
Font Style | Best For | Font Size Range |
---|---|---|
Sans-serif | Easy reading, signs, and headers | 50-150 pt |
Serif | Formal documents, invitations | 60-180 pt |
Cursive | Creative projects, invitations | 40-120 pt |
Block Letters | Children’s projects, posters | 80-200 pt |
Experiment with different fonts and sizes for the best results. Adjusting the style to suit your project will enhance its visual appeal and functionality.
